FAQ
- What is Snap-on's non-controlling interests?
- Snap-on (SNA) reported non-controlling interests of $25M in Q2 2026.
- How has Snap-on's non-controlling interests changed year-over-year?
- Snap-on's non-controlling interests increased by 4.2% year-over-year, from $24M to $25M.
- What is the long-term trend for Snap-on's non-controlling interests?
-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), Snap-on's non-controlling interests has grown at a 2.9%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$21.7M to $25M.
- What does non-controlling interests mean?
- Equity attributable to minority shareholders in subsidiaries not fully owned by the parent — their proportional claim on subsidiary net assets.
